HomeMy WebLinkAboutFinance - Accounting Manager Accounting Manager Page 1 Council Approved 1/18/2021 Revised 10-2021, 7-2023 City of Waukee JOB DESCRIPTION Job Title: Accounting Manager Reports to: Finance Director Dept/Div: Finance Direct Reports: Senior Accountant, Payroll Specialist, Pay Grade: N32 Accounting Clerk FLSA Status: Exempt – Executive JOB PURPOSE: Experienced accounting position responsible for coordinating and leading a wide range of financial accounting and reporting activities. Manages Finance Department staff and supports annual functions such as budget and audit preparation. 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S: (Order of Essential Functions does not indicate importance of functions.) 1. Provides direct supervision to Finance Department staff in accordance with City policies and applicable laws. Responsibilities include selection, development and training of personnel; planning, assigning, and directing work; appraising performance; addressing complaints, resolving problems and taking appropriate disciplinary action when necessary. 2. Assists with coordination of annual operating budget, CIP budget and budget amendment processes while providing budget estimates, calculations and projections to various departments. 3. Assists in the preparation of Tax Increment Financing (TIF), including management of TIF debt, payment of financial rebate incentives, and state reporting requirements. 4. Prepares and files the Street Finance Report, Annual State Financial Report, Annual TIF Certification Report, and Budget Amendment. 5. Supervises fixed asset accounting and City equipment inventories and develops an overall plan for the financing and replacement of equipment and facilities. 6. Calculates and processes monthly journal entries including sinking funds, personnel and supply reimbursements. 7. Processes new bond sale deposits and tracks semiannual bond payment processing. 8. Coordinates the annual financial audit and audits of compliance issues for federal, state and local laws and regulations. 9. QUALIFICATIONS: 1. Bachelor’s Degree in accounting, financial management or closely related field. 2. Three (3) years of work experience in financial management. Municipal experience preferred. 3. Two (2) years of supervisory/leadership experience with increasing responsibility in a related field. 4. Must possess a valid driver’s license and meet the requirements of the City’s motor vehicle policy. 5. Advanced accounting certificate including CPA and/or CPFO preferred. PHYSICAL REQUIREMENTS: While performing the duties of this job, the employee is regularly required to sit, stand and move about the office; use hands to finger, handle or feel objects, tools or controls; and reach with hands and arms. The employee is required to speak, hear and see in order to share information, receive instructions and complete tasks using a computer screen. The employee must occasionally lift and/or move up to 25 pounds. WORKING CONDITIONS: 1. Climate controlled office with hazards typical to that environment. 2. Position requires travel within and outside of the City, which imposes common travel hazards. 3. Standard work hours are Monday – Friday 8:00 AM – 5:00 PM and may occasionally include meetings, presentations and events during evenings and weekends. 4.
